Fun with vampires…

I am currently running a modern, urban fantasy RPG campaign (using the cypher system) and one of the fun parts about the setting is that the vampires etc. are not set for (un)life. For one thing, vampires were human when ‘alive’ and the human mind has - limitations. So older vampires (~200 years+) tend to be sequestered away due to memory issues. Like being convinced Reagan is obviously still the president and the like.

Another issue is that some humans are aware of the supernatural, so vampires tend to be driven from places more often than not. It’s rather hard to maintain wealth when you’re fleeing for your unlife. (Also, vampires are hardly immune to events like the Dutch Tulip Mania and losing funds that way.) At present, a lot of their wealth goes into fake identities and the like. a problem less long-lived supernatural creatures don’t have to consider at all.

Ironically, the modern age has made it easier to keep/transfer wealth with offshore banking and the like, but it’s also that much more expensive and difficult to be hidden so while this is a net positive, vampires on the whole aren’t nearly as wealthy as they like others to think they are.
